The dogs have been at peace, and all has seemingly gone well. However soon the monstrous bear Monsoon attacks, wanting to claim Futago Pass as his own. All the while getting vengeance for his father, Akakabuto who was killed by Gin during the events of Ginga Nagareboshi Gin. Victory is not assured for the dogs, as an aging Gin has started to go blind. And the Supreme Commander Weed is fatally injured by one of Monsoon's kin. Weed's children have been sent away for training, and are oblivious to the crisis at hand. Can the soldiers of Ouu defeat this new take on an old threat? Or is this truly be to their last fight?

The year is 1960, in a snowy mountain village in Oshu. My son, Otto, who will be starting elementary school that year, is surrounded by nature, animals, and his family. Though poor, he is absorbed in the bountiful days. His father doesn't work and spends all his time yelling at his family, his mother is compassionate, and his siblings share his father's tyranny. Otto, the youngest son, is at the mercy of his family, but he continues to embark on small adventures... (Source: Nihonbungeisha, translated)

Makoto wants to become a Tosa dog fighting trainer. His sumo Father Rouou gets him a brown puppy, but is it really a Tosa? Makoto finds out in shock that his dog is not a Tosa, but in fact a Siberian Wolf, but decides to make his dog "Zero" a fighting dog. But Makoto does not know that Zero's mother had been killed by Anzai's Yokozuna Tosa "Unryū" right in front of him, and he competes in the showring with the sole intention of getting revenge on Unryū.
